PrintStyle Property (IHatch)

Gets or sets the name of the PrintStyle for this Hatch.

Property Value

Name of the PrintStyle

Remarks

You can only set the name of a PrintStyle if named PrintStyles are used in the drawing. If color-dependent PrintStyles are used in the drawing, then the PrintStyle is set to ByColor and is read only. To determine the type of PrintStyle used in the document:

  • call IDocument::GetCommandOptionString and specify dsCommandOptionString_e.dsCommandOptionString_GetNmPrnStyl for the Var parameter in a project, macro, or script.
  • click Tools > Options > System Options, expand Printing, expand Default settings, and examine Default type in the user-interface.
